Mary Pope Osborne is a renowned American author, best known for her immensely popular Magic Tree House series of children's books. Her adventurous historical fiction and fantasy tales, featuring siblings Jack and Annie, transport young readers to different times and places. Titles like "Vacation Under the Volcano," "A Big Day for Baseball," and "Civil War on Sunday" exemplify her engaging storytelling that combines education with excitement, inspiring millions of children worldwide.

Get ready to meet some of America's most amazing and hilarious heroes! In this collection of American Tall Tales, you'll discover nine wildly exaggerated and super funny stories that will make you laugh out loud. Imagine Paul Bunyan, a giant lumberjack who could chop down ten trees with one swing, or John Henry, whose mighty hammer could outwork a machine! You'll also meet brave Mose, the biggest fireman in old New York, and Sally Ann Thunder Ann Whirlwind, who could outrun, outsnort, and outlie any creature. These incredible characters come to life with their unbelievable adventures and larger-than-life personalities. Dive into these classic stories and find out how these unforgettable American folk heroes made their mark in the wilderness and beyond. Perfect for reading aloud or discovering on your own, these tales are packed with courage, humor, and a whole lot of fun!
